[gtk/matthiasc/for-master: 101/104] docs: Don't point at mailing lists



commit 1ef6a35f3e18c8bfb5c0d464c1207bcec4d7b351
Author: Matthias Clasen <mclasen redhat com>
Date:   Tue May 12 01:02:49 2020 -0400

    docs: Don't point at mailing lists
    
    Replace references to the mailing lists by
    discourse + irc.

 docs/reference/gtk/resources.xml | 91 ++++++----------------------------------
 1 file changed, 12 insertions(+), 79 deletions(-)
